Effects Of Different Management Methods For Pinus Koraiensis Forest On Soil Properties

According to the theory and method of near-to-nature forest management,from the soil properties aspect,based on the different degree of near-to-nature,four kinds of Pinus koraiensis stands differ in management type and four kinds of Pinus koraiensis plantations differ in management measure were investigated in Liangshui natural reserve located in Lesser Xingan Mountations,and the litter reserves,the concentration of organic matter,soil physical properties,soil water holding capacity,soil chemical properties and soil microbial properties were studied systematiclly.The difference of soil bulk density among different management type of Pinus koraiensis stands was significant,ranges from 0.71g/cm~3 to 1.08g/cm~3 in the decline order of Beaula playphylla and Pinus koraiensisⅠstand,Pinus koraiensis plantation,Beaula playphylla and Pinus koraiensisⅡstand,and virgin Pinus koraiensis stand.Soil total porosity percent of virgin Pinus koraiensis stand was higher than that of Pinus koraiensis plantation,soil saturated holding capacity was in the decline order of virgin Pinus koraiensis stand,Beaula playphylla and Pinus koraiensisⅡstand,Pinus koraiensis plantation and Beaula playphylla and Pinus koraiensisⅠstand,soil capillary water holding capacity and field moisture capacity were in the decline order of virgin Pinus koraiensis stand,Beaula playphylla and Pinus koraiensisⅠstand,Pinus koraiensis plantation and Beaula playphylla and Pinus koraiensisⅡstand,significant differences were detected among different origin of stands.Both of organic substances content and the total amount of nutrient elements for virgin Pinus koraiensis stand and two kinds of Beaula playphylla and Pinus koraiensis stands were higher than that of Pinus koraiensis plantation.The difference of total amount of nutrient elements and alkaline content among different origin of Pinus koraiensis stands was significant,in the decline order of two kinds of Beaula playphylla and Pinus koraiensis stands,virgin Pinus koraiensis stand and Pinus koraiensis plantation.Available P content was in the decline oreder of virgin Pinus koraiensis stand,two kinds of Beaula playphylla and Pinus koraiensis stand,and Pinus koraiensis plantation.The amount of the numbers of the soil microorganisms for virgin Pinus koraiensis stand and two kinds of Beaula playphylla and Pinus koraiensis stand was higher than that of virgin Korean pine stand.The numbers of bacteria and actinomyceto were highest in two kinds of Beaula playphylla and Pinus koraiensis stands.The numbers of azotobacter were highest in virgin Pinus koraiensis stands.Litter reserves of Pinus koraiensis plantation with various management measures was in the decline order of the control,even cutting,cutting shrub keeping canopy,cutting canopy keeping shrub and cutting all non-crop trees.Non-decomposed litter layer of cutting all non- crop trees and cutting canopy keeping shrub shared a larger proportion of total litter reserves, while semi-decomposed litter layer of the control,even cutting cutting shrub keeping canopy shared a larger proportion of total litter reserves.The soil bulk density was 0.71g/cm~3~1.08g/cm~3,and the lowest was cutting shrub keeping canopy.The decline order of the soil gross porosity was cutting canopy keeping shrub,even cutting,control,cutting all non-crop trees and cutting shrub keeping canopy.Saturated soil water holding capacity,capillary water holding capacity and field capacity were all in the decline order of cutting shrub keeping canopy,cutting all non-crop trees,even cutting,control and cutting canopy keeping shrub.But different management measures had no significantly impact on soil water holding capacity. Soil organic matter and nutrient elements account for the highest value in the stand of even cutting.Seasonal variation of soil available nutrient content showed different triends based on difference of management measures,soil available nutrient contenteven was highest in even cutting and lowest in cutting all non-crop trees and cutting canopy keeping shrub.The number of bacteria and fungi showed the same seasonal trend with a single peak,the maximum appeared in July and August.The number of actinomycetes showed the trend of low to high in the stand of cutting all non-crop trees and cutting canopy keeping shrub,and the trend of high to low in the stand of cutting shrub keeping canopy and even cutting.The number of bacterium, fungi and actinomycetes was in the decline order of cutting shrub keeping canopy,even cutting, control,cutting all non-crop trees and cutting canopy keeping shrub,control,cutting shrub keeping canopy,cutting canopy keeping shrub,even cutting and cutting all non-crop trees,and cutting shrub keeping canopy,even cutting,cutting canopy keeping shrub,cutting all non-crop trees and control respectively.Both study about soil properties under different management type and different management measures of Pinus koraiensis forest confirmed that improving the species composition and stand structure could be conducive to improving the soil quality of Pinus koraiensis forest.The results provided a theoretical basis for near-to-nature management of Pinus koraiensis plantation.
